Fresh from "Bones" season 12 renewal, executive producer Michael Peterson revealed that they are treating each and every episode as if it were their last. Multiple reports claim that the show will eventually come to an end after its 12-year run.

In an interview with Zap2It, Peterson said that their plans for Booth (David Boreanaz) and Brennan (Emily Deschanel) have been mapped out. He explained that they were just embracing the renewal and were hoping for the best. Peterson added that the studio had been very supportive to the producers, writers and the cast.

"Looking at Season 12, we're just saying, 'Make this an event. Make this something where every episode really counts.'"

Peterson revealed that "Bones" season 12 aims to tie the loose ends in Booth and Brennan's story. He shared that they reviewed some of the episodes in the early seasons and noticed that there were a few arcs that seemed unfinished. He hinted that "Bones" was supposed to end by season 11 but because they wanted to give fans a satisfying conclusion, they went ahead and pitched for another season.  

Speaking to TV Insider, Peterson thanked Fox for giving them another season, an opportunity to end things right. He explained that most of "Bones" season 12 will likely feature Booth and Brennan and some of the personal arcs which have not been addressed since the first season.

Peterson also shared that fans will be taken on a rollercoaster ride come "Bones" season 12. He shared that while Booth and Brennan's final season may not go on smoothly, he promised fans that they were writing the final episodes from the fans' perspective. Peterson shared that they just needed to trust the writers on this one, adding that they were after all, fans of the show.

"We'll put you through a lot, but we'll come out in a very good place," he explained.

In the interview, Peterson also mentioned that they are not closing doors to the possibility of another crossover. He explained that they enjoyed the "Sleepy Hollow" crossover and would want to do another one in a different series in the future. Zap2It author Lindsay Macdonald suggested doing a "Bones - Lucifer" crossover, which Peterson thought would be a good idea.
